Process for Requesting Accident Reports

To request accident reports from the designated authorities, individuals must follow a specific process.

In the case of the St Matthews Police Department in St Matthews, South Carolina, the process is as follows.

Firstly, the individual must complete a request form, which can be obtained online or in person at the police department. The form requires specific information such as the date, time, and location of the accident, as well as the names of the parties involved. Additionally, the requester must provide a valid reason for accessing the report.

Once the form is completed, it must be submitted along with any required fees. The police department will then review the request and, if approved, provide the requester with a copy of the accident report.

It is important to note that the process may vary depending on the jurisdiction and specific requirements of the designated authorities.

Importance of Accurate Accident Reporting

Accurate reporting of accidents is vital for ensuring the reliability of data and facilitating a comprehensive understanding of the factors contributing to traffic incidents.

Accurate accident reports provide valuable information about the location, time, and circumstances surrounding an accident, which can be used for statistical analysis and trend identification.

Reliable accident data is crucial for transportation planning, policy-making, and resource allocation. It allows policymakers to identify high-risk areas and develop targeted interventions to improve road safety.

Additionally, accurate accident reports can assist law enforcement agencies in investigating and prosecuting traffic violations. They provide an objective record of the incident, including the sequence of events, contributing factors, and potential witnesses.

Without accurate reporting, there is a risk of misinterpretation, incomplete analysis, and a lack of evidence-based decision-making in addressing traffic safety concerns.
